🎙️ Too Young to Be Old: The Wild History of Skincare—From Cold Creams to TikTok TrendsEver wondered why skincare fads come and go—or why we’re still chasing the next miracle cream at any age? In this candid, witty episode, Diane Gilman takes you on a personal journey through eight decades of beauty routines, celebrity endorsements, and the science (and marketing) behind what we put on our faces. From Ponds cold cream and sunburn remedies to La Mer, red light therapy, and TikTok’s wildest trends, Diane reveals what actually works, what’s just hype, and why looking good is always worth it.In This Episode:Skincare Through the Decades: Diane shares how beauty standards shifted from porcelain skin in the 1940s to the sun-kissed look of the 1960s and 70s, and how each era’s icons—from movie stars to supermodels—influenced what we bought and believed.The Rise of Drugstore & Department Store Brands: From Ponds and Nivea to the explosion of infomercials and celebrity skincare lines, discover how marketing shaped our routines and our wallets.The Sunburn Era: Why baby boomers worshipped the sun, the rise of tanning salons, and the harsh reality of skin cancer and anti-aging panic.The Anti-Aging Boom: How new ingredients like collagen and hyaluronic acid promised to turn back the clock—and why some products (like La Mer) became lifelong obsessions.Infomercials, Influencers & TikTok: The evolution from TV ads to social media, and why we’re still tempted by “miracle” products, from snail slime to bee venom and beef tallow.The Power of Story: Why the best skincare brands sell a dream—and how Diane learned to spot the difference between hype and real results.Back to Nature: The return of small-batch, farm-to-face products, and why goat milk creams, seaweed serums, and even beef tallow are making a comeback.Beauty from the Inside Out: Diane’s take on ingestible beauty—collagen, mushroom coffee, and targeted smoothies—and why what you eat matters as much as what you apply.Red Light Therapy & Tech: How new gadgets are changing the game for aging skin, and why discipline (not just dollars) is the real secret to results.The Bottom Line: Why looking good is about feeling good, and how the right routine can boost your confidence at any age.PLUS:✨ AMRA Supplements – Diane shares her discovery of this "miracle" supplement containing collagen, peptides, vitamins, and minerals that helps combat age-related nutrient absorption issues.
